What is a midwife?

     "A midwife is a person who is qualified to practice midwifery. She is trained
to give the necessary care and advice to women during pregnancy, labor and the
postpartum period, to conduct normal deliveries on her own responsibility and to
care for the newly born infant."

-World Health Organization
